Open House Exceeded our Expectations

Close than 200 people attended. Many winelovers from the West Coast Wine Network, Vinocellar, and Erobertparker message boards were there checking out:
- 2002 Eno Pinot Noir "Presumed Innocent"
- 2002 Eno Zinfandel "Caught Red Handed"
- 2002 Eno Syrah "Plead the Fifth"
- 2003 Eno Pinot Noir "The Great Promise"
- 2003 Eno Zinfandel "The Hero's Journey"
- 2003 Eno Syrah "The Old Soul"
Even one of my wine heroes, Ed Kurtzman, the the former winemaker at Testarossa and now the winemaker at August West, Fort Ross, and Freeman showed up AND bought wine. At one point the lines were 4 people deep. I felt like we were hosting a big party. I hardly had a chance to have quality time with anyone.
The party exceeded all of our expectations!
